背景情况:
- 多囊卵巢综合征 (PCOS) 是一种复杂的内分泌疾病,影响生育年龄的女性.
- 由于PCOS的多因素病因仍然不完全理解,特别是在饮食,生活方式和社会经济影响方面.
研究的目的:
- 研究多囊卵巢综合症 (PCOS) 与各种饮食,饮食行为,生活方式和社会经济因素之间的关联.
主要方法:
- 一项匹配对病例控制研究,涉及150名患有PCOS的妇女和150名健康的对照.
- 数据收集包括关于饮食,饮食行为,体力活动,人体测量和社会经济地位的标准问卷.
- 使用条件多变量逻辑回归来计算调整的赔率比率 (AmOR).
主要成果:
- 低教育水平 (AmOR = 8.44) 和高糖消费 (AmOR = 11.61) 与增加PCOS风险显著相关.
- 更高的身体质量指数 (BMI) 和身体不活动也与PCOS有关.
- 认知饮食限制 (AmOR = 0.79),原料纤维 (AmOR = 0.61) 和蛋白质摄入量表明对PCOS有保护作用.
结论:
- 低教育程度可能会使个人倾向于不健康的饮食和生活方式选择,导致肥胖和PCOS风险升高.
- 饮食因素,包括纤维和蛋白质,以及认知抑制在PCOS病因和预防中发挥作用.

The menstrual cycle includes a critical component known as the ovarian cycle, which undergoes two main phases each month—the follicular phase and the luteal phase. The follicular phase is variable and averaging around 14 days. Ovulation, triggered by a surge in luteinizing hormone (LH), marks the transition between the two phases. In most organisms, sex is determined by the ratio of X and Y chromosomes. However, in some organisms, such as Drosophila and C.elegans, sex is determined by the ratio of the number of X chromosomes to the number of sets of autosomes. The Y chromosome in Drosophila is active but does not determine sex. It contains genes responsible for the production of sperms in adult flies.

A single nucleotide polymorphism or SNP is a single nucleotide variation at a specific genomic position in a large population. It is the most prevalent type of sequence variation found in the human genome. Point mutations that occur in more than 1% of the population qualify as SNPs. These are present once every 1000 nucleotides on an average in the human genome.
